South Dearborn HS Student Named To Truth Initiative National Youth Council

Congratulations to Arissa Riley!

Arissa Riley. Photo provided.

(Dearborn County, Ind.) - A South Dearborn High School junior has been named to the Truth Initiative National Youth Council. 

Arissa Riley, Dearborn County Youth Ambassador and VOICE Indiana leader, will join teens from across the country to gain valuable leadership and advocacy skills. 

Riley, along with other teens, will attend Truth Initiative meetings, workshops, and trainings to teach skills from current tobacco abuse problems in their communities to any social or political issue that a teen may feel passionate about. All members will hold a Virtual Action Summit to bring the  resources gained to their community and schools.

“I was proud to nominate Arissa, she is a multi-tasker who never loses focus on the main objective. She will be a valuable asset to Truth just as she is a valuable asset to us here in Dearborn County,” says Amy Rose Youth Coordinator for CASA and VOICE Dearborn County.
